Product Overview

The Poly G7500 JITC certified video system (842T6AA#ABA) is the Department of Defense procurement configuration of the G7500 modular room platform, bundling the 4K UHD codec, an EagleEye IV 12x optical zoom PTZ camera, a Poly TC8 touch controller, and a Poly IP tabletop microphone. It carries both GSA/TAA compliance for federal contract award and Joint Interoperability Test Command certification, which is the DoD requirement for placing a video endpoint on the Defense Information Systems Network. The codec is certified for Microsoft Teams and Zoom and supports standards-based H.323 and SIP for existing defense video infrastructure. Specify this SKU where the accreditation package requires a JITC-listed endpoint.

Product Description

JITC certification is the distinguishing attribute of this part number, and it is not interchangeable with TAA compliance. TAA governs country of origin and determines whether a product can be awarded on a federal contract; JITC certification is the result of interoperability testing conducted by the Joint Interoperability Test Command and determines whether the endpoint may be connected to DoD networks that require listed equipment. Programs writing an accreditation package against DISA requirements generally cannot substitute the standard GSA/TAA SKU for this one, even though the hardware is the same modular codec. If the facility also prohibits RF emitters, the No Radio variant is the correct part number instead.

The room package is built for command conference rooms and briefing spaces. The G7500 codec encodes and decodes with H.264 AVC, H.264 High Profile, and H.265, delivering people video up to 4K at 30 fps and content input and output up to UHD 3840 x 2160 at 5 to 60 fps. Two HDMI outputs drive separate people and content displays, and one HDMI input accepts a room PC or presenter laptop. The EagleEye IV camera connects over the supplied HDCI cable with 12x optical zoom, pan, and tilt, which matters when the camera is at the display and the far end of a command table is well beyond the useful range of a digital crop. The bundled IP tabletop microphone connects over standard Ethernet and draws PoE+ from one of the codec's three dedicated 10/100/1G LAN ports.

For the integrator building the accreditation package, the relevant details are the security and control surfaces. Media encryption uses AES-128 and AES-256 with H.235.6, management interfaces run over TLS 1.0 through 1.2, and administrative access is authenticated. The codec supports IPv4 and IPv6, exposes RS-232 and a REST API for a third-party control processor, and accepts up to three HDMI or USB cameras with switching from the touch interface. Poly NoiseBlockAI and Poly Acoustic Fence suppress non-speech noise and out-of-zone voices, which is worth having in shared spaces where adjacent conversation must stay off the call. Companion items usually specified alongside this system are the Poly EagleEye IV camera mounting bracket, a Poly IP ceiling microphone array for rooms where table microphones are impractical, and a spare Poly TC8 touch controller.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the difference between JITC certification and TAA compliance?
They answer different questions. TAA compliance governs country of origin and determines whether the product can be awarded on a federal contract. JITC certification is the outcome of interoperability testing by the Joint Interoperability Test Command and determines whether the endpoint may be placed on DoD networks that require listed equipment. This part number carries both.

Can the standard GSA/TAA SKU be substituted for this one?
Not where the accreditation package specifies a JITC-listed endpoint. The hardware is the same modular codec, camera, controller, and microphone, but the 842T6AA#ABA part number is the one that carries the JITC certification. Substituting the 842T5AA GSA/TAA SKU will not satisfy a DISA requirement for listed equipment.

Does this build have wireless enabled?
Yes. This configuration includes Wi-Fi 802.11a/b/g/n/ac with MIMO and Bluetooth 5.0. Facilities that prohibit RF emitters entirely should specify the No Radio GSA/TAA variant, which is supplied without operable wireless radios.

Which components ship in the bundle?
The Poly G7500 4K codec, the EagleEye IV 12x PTZ camera with HDCI cable, the Poly TC8 touch controller, and a Poly IP tabletop microphone. Displays, camera mounting hardware, and additional microphone arrays are ordered separately.

What encryption and network details does the accreditation package need?
Media encryption uses AES-128 and AES-256 with H.235.6 support, and management interfaces run over TLS 1.0, 1.1, and 1.2 with authenticated administrative access. The codec supports IPv4 and IPv6 dual-stack addressing and H.323 and SIP signaling at up to 6 Mbps with dynamic bandwidth allocation.

How is the room scaled for more participants?
The codec supplies PoE+ on three dedicated 10/100/1G LAN ports and supports up to three IP microphone arrays with roughly 20 ft. of pickup range each. It also accepts up to three HDMI or USB cameras with source switching from the touch interface, so a presenter camera can be added to a command table camera.

Can this be driven by an existing control system?
Yes. RS-232 and a REST API allow a third-party control processor to handle call control, camera selection, and display routing, which is standard practice when the room is part of a larger integrated AV design rather than a standalone endpoint.
